The new Schuke organ in the Performing Arts Center in Pingtung (Taiwan) has III manuals and pedal with 45 stops on slider chests, which are controlled purely electrically.
The console is movable and can be used at organ level as well as on the orchestra podium. It can also be transported on the rollable platform by means of an elevator.
The disposition corresponds to a pure concert organ with French and German romantic influences but also with a speciality: the Flûte formosa 2′ made of bamboo as a tribute to the island of Taiwan, where bamboo plants can grow freely.
